Do Tuesday Really the Best Day for Cheap copyright Flights?
Lots of air enthusiasts are always searching for the best deals on flights. One piece of wisdom you often come across is that Tuesdays are the best priced days to book copyright tickets. This theory has been around for years, but is there any truth to it? The reality can be a bit mixed. While there's no promise that you'll always snag a bargain on Tuesday, there are some influences at play that might make it a little more probable.
- Take for instance, airlines often release their weekly sales on Tuesdays.
- Plus, many people are busy with work or other commitments during the week, meaning Tuesday flights might be comparatively in demand.
However, keep in mind that airfare prices are constantly fluctuating based on a multitude of variables. Elements including the time of year, destination, fuel costs, and even past events can all affect ticket prices. So while Tuesday might be a good starting point for your travel search, don't dismiss other days completely.
The best strategy is to be open to change, compare prices across different days, and use flight tracking tools to warn you when fares drop. Happy traveling!
